Type
ORACLE
Validation date
2024-11-21 10:17: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01746,
    "usd": 0.01839
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001566D91A8F225BAFCA84947BE3753E4E32998E7640FE3C76ACA031A0E55E09FE2

Previous signature

41369110011DB02CB4E20BFA19C52558BC38D449431853D904FF5790D7C4ABA2D2B4926B0FF388205898DD45EDB59D72E4522DD3264D8D6772911C828E15B20F

Origin signature

3044022008DE483C1D29757F5605328305836D6F1C19301BA02EFCB1410FBC9B452A86EA0220315897443CCF54B1CC77F28D53D716D1B77FFAFADC6230C1BEF94C1DBD2ED540

Proof of work

010104119BDD4DB10EF796F97BB66C4E8AD3923C8BA3EF94230BBC5DEF7D1B8E7DC9E70A42D70C3554BC7ECE06BC130937F1C6B21DC680825D3DCA011A20D33F941FE3

Proof of integrity

004B155EB890500CF59EFF916FB7522DED58536678203D54002B54F39C9450B45A

Coordinator signature

55685091CD639777F413799E5C3D17142EE9F21B7463E04469A92594D35AD0ED00F2337CC21D7C013C5D8D76218A69DEAE1AA514817AC12E9F134CCD91E8FE03

Validator #1 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#1 signature

E4C84C053082750FC479237FF6C8943BDCBC6D56FA4D5FE1543E46AA8A762135ADD0A3B637573CBB188FEEB900B139D93C4A4B94A32188378260702A1BB59F08

Validator #2 public key

00016A24FA6FC34A345FB22A7E90CB6BC583AEA140B679549F745FB51D59A93F7868

Validator #2 signature

458C3045553DBAD217B815A6C629C5A6BC5A7A4ED3066B256C49DF9625206F05D6E69A7E31A4F2262996CFF635FF7D361F463C34442542941651168022F83800